The watchdog monitors plugin heartbeats and restarts unresponsive kiosk sessions. In the sandbox environment, timeouts are deliberately generous so you can attach a debugger without triggering a restart; production is far stricter, and repeated restarts will quarantine your plugin until it is re-reviewed. Test against staging before submitting, since staging matches production timing exactly. The watchdog's per-environment settings are listed below.

deployment values, kajep-kageg:
[praix]
host = praix.paliqcorp.corp
user = praix_svc
database = praix_prod

**Action item (Brookmere Marathon postmortem):** the chip reader dropped reads when runners bunched at the finish mat because the RF poll window and dedupe buffer were sized for training runs, not race density. Fix: widen the poll window, grow the dedupe buffer, and add backpressure to the upload queue. Reviewer, please verify the new constants against peak-density replay logs.

tuning table, yajog-yahof:
BUDGETS = {
    "lamvan": 303,
    "wenox": 460,
    "fenvan": 525,
}

Branch managers: we will transition tier-one customer support to an external provider, Fennwick Assist, starting in the Dunmore and Calloway regions. In-house teams retain escalations and warranty cases. Expect a six-week parallel run; report call-quality metrics weekly. Headcount changes will be handled through redeployment first. Training packs arrive next Monday. Do not discuss the transition with customers until the announcement. The confidential note below outlines the broader plan driving this change.

confidential, kagup-bafog: Fraaxax Group is in early talks to buy Soroxox Group for about $343.8 million. The Olidor launch date is June 14, and nothing goes to the press before then. Legal wants the Aldmirek Logistics term sheet signed before July 23.

// Client setup for the Farelight rate-parity checker.
// This service polls published room rates across the Orvano and
// Bellhurst booking channels and flags any property whose direct
// rate diverges by more than 2% from channel rates. New team
// members: the poller runs every 15 minutes and writes findings
// to the parity ledger in Quillstone; do not shorten the interval,
// as the channels throttle aggressively. The client authenticates
// to the internal Farelight aggregation gateway using the key
// immediately below.

gateway credential: kto23_LX9A4ys6i4nzHtpOLNLodKK